Hernando County teams in prep baseball playoff games

- Advertisement -

By Andy Villamarzo  
Hernando Sun sports writer 

Prep baseball season is winding down around the state of Florida but there’s still two teams from Hernando County that remain in the mix.

In Class 6A, Springstead is coming off a dominating district championship victory against rival Dunnellon and the rival Eagles are now looking to set their sights on a deep postseason run and it begins against the Colts. 
The Eagles were expected to reach the playoffs, but in Class 5A, Central enters with a record of 6-21 and surprised everyone by defeating Nature Coast and upending Hudson Fivay for the chance to host a playoff game. 

Both regional quarterfinal games will be played in Hernando County, so let’s take a closer look at the matchups for Springstead and Central. 

Citra North Marion (16-11) at Springstead (22-4): Fresh off of winning the Class 6A, District 6 championship against district foe Dunnellon, Springstead now shifts its focus to Citra North Marion. The Colts have few common opponents with the Eagles, as North Marion has faced teams like Dunnellon. North Marion faced Dunnellon twice during the regular season and lost by scores of 3-2 and 10-9, respectively. The Eagles got the better of the Tigers in the last go around, upending Dunnellon 9-4 to win the district crown. With a chance to move up the region bracket fairly quickly, Springstead will start pitcher Jack Jasiak on the mound against the Colts. With Springstead sending their ace in for the start, the Eagles are hoping the senior punches their ticket to the region semifinal. 

- Advertisement -

Atlantic (11-9) at Central (6-21): When talking about a Cinderella-type story, you have to mention the season the Bears endured in 2018. Central wasn’t looked at to be a postseason contender by any means as they strolled into the Class 5A, District 7 tournament with just three victories and 21 losses. Since then, the Bears have racked up three straight victories and along with Fivay (9-16), were able to finish below the .500 mark and clinch postseason berths. Now Central rides a three game winning streak heading into the Class 5A postseason and they face an Atlantic team that is coming off a 1-0 loss to Orlando Bishop Moore in the Class 5A, District 8 title game. The Bears will rely upon the pitching of sophomore Ryan Ebberup, whom is 2-5 on the season with an earned run average of 3.84. Winner will face the winner of the Hudson Fivay-Orlando Bishop Moore matchup. 

While Hernando High headed into districts in the No. 1 seed, they lost to Fivay in the semi-final 5-1.
